Measure what matters with Entosight® Neo


One of the biggest challenges facing the insect farming industry is unreliable technology leading to inconsistencies in production. Sample counting, widely used by many insect companies, is labour-intensive and prone to human error. Due to the small size of neonates, some companies delay counting and sampling until several days after hatching, leading to larvae of varying ages and sizes and imprecise dosing. Such variations in larval dosing can increase the Feed Conversion Ratio (FCR), reducing efficiency and increasing costs.

Technical specifications


Machine vision accuracy: +95% accuracy


Dosing capacity: 3000 neonates per-second


Dimensions (LxWxH): 2000x2000x1900mm


Power requirements: 6 kW (Max)


Weight: 280 kg
